Hatchery Project Update for Rivers Inlet Nov. 23rd

A few weeks back our crew of dedicated anglers were up at the Head of Rivers Inlet in one of the three main Rivers that feeds Rivers Inlet, the Wannock River. The purpose was to get the eggs and milk from the spawning salmon to hatch some babies for our private hatchery that is funded by our Lodge Association. Not only were they battling these might Rivers Inlet chinook salmon on rod and reel they were battling the stormy fall weather.

There were several BIG females taken including this 48 lbs. salmon that you can see pictured below. In just 2 days the crew estimated that they were able to harvest over 300,000 eggs which they mixed with the milk and are incubating right now at the hatchery. They figure that the run was stronger this year by the numbers of fish they encountered. We know that from the summer of great fishing that we have at the mouth of Rivers Inlet. The crew will have a better idea of the size of the run when they do the "head pitch count" in a few weeks. Counting the dead salmon carcasses on the river bank is another good way to estimate the number of fish that have returned.

As many of you know, for over 25 years our Association of Rivers Inlet lodges has operated a privately funded hatchery to raise salmon.

Last week, we received a 'good news' report from the hatchery crew. The 2010 brood Wannock River chinook salmon, which were being raised in the hatchery, were flown to the sea pens in Rivers Inlet. A total of 254,619 healthy 2.8 gm fry were transported by float plane with very little mortality. It did not take long for these salmon fry to recover from their trip and start feeding. There are still approximately 29,000 tagged salmon fry (we only tag 10%) at the hatchery which will be transported to the sea pens in a few weeks. That makes the overall total in excess of 280,000 Rivers Inlet chinook ...

The Rivers Inlet/Hakai fishing lodges & their guests have supported several hatchery projects over the past 26 years to the tune of more than $3m.

Our latest project has been to enhance the coho/silvers in the Johnston Creek which is half way up Rivers Inlet near Wadhams. This project was initiated by our group with the direct co-operation of the Department of Fisheries and Oceans (DFO), Canada.
It is an ongoing project with brood stocks taken in late 2007, 2008, 2009 & 2010.
Last season, in 2010, we were delighted to be the first lodge to report a return of one of our tagged 2007 coho to Rivers Inlet. In July, the catcher of this coho travelled all the way from Hawaii to fish with us. Here is what she said:

You will see from the photo that when the coho are ready to spawn they turn red.

We take this opportunity to thank Sandie MacLaurin (DFO) and her team for all the support and hard work. In an email to Barbara on February 4, 2011, Sandie stated, "... because of the commitment of your group (lodges), and the passion they have for the salmon resource, these exciting and successful projects can be undertaken by DFO. The lodges' willingness to collect and report accurate catch data and participate with their guests in the Salmon Head Recovery Program (sending tagged salmon heads to DFO), ensures a sustainable fishery for today's guests and their families into the future".
